evaluate the following permutation: 9p4
Answer
Answer:
3024
Explanation:
Step1: Recall permutation formula
The permutation formula is ${n}P{r}=\frac{n!}{(n - r)!}$. Here $n = 9$ and $r=4$.
Step2: Calculate factorial values
$n!=n\times(n - 1)\times\cdots\times1$. So $9! = 9\times8\times7\times6\times5\times4\times3\times2\times1$ and $(9 - 4)!=5!=5\times4\times3\times2\times1$. Then ${9}P{4}=\frac{9!}{(9 - 4)!}=\frac{9!}{5!}$.
Step3: Simplify the expression
$\frac{9!}{5!}=\frac{9\times8\times7\times6\times5!}{5!}=9\times8\times7\times6$.
Step4: Perform multiplication
$9\times8 = 72$, $72\times7=504$, $504\times6 = 3024$.
